description We report measurements of partial branching fractions for inclusive charmless semileptonic B decays B̅ →Xuℓν̅ and the determination of the Cabibbo–Kobayashi–Maskawa (CKM) matrix element |Vub|. The analysis is based on a sample of 467×10[superscript 6] Υ(4S)→BB̅ decays recorded with the BABAR detector at the PEP-II e[superscript +]e[superscript -] storage rings. We select events in which the decay of one of the B mesons is fully reconstructed and an electron or a muon signals the semileptonic decay of the other B meson. We measure partial branching fractions ΔB in several restricted regions of phase space and determine the CKM element |V[subscript ub]| based on different QCD predictions. For decays with a charged lepton momentum p[subscript ℓ][superscript *]>1.0  GeV in the B meson rest frame, we obtain ΔB=(1.80±0.13[subscript stat]±0.15[subscript sys]±0.02[subscript theo])×10[superscript -3] from a fit to the two-dimensional M[subscript X]-q[superscript 2] distribution. Here, M[subscript X] refers to the invariant mass of the final state hadron X and q[superscript 2] is the invariant mass squared of the charged lepton and neutrino. From this measurement we extract |V[subscript ub]|=(4.33±0.24[subscript exp]±0.15[subscript theo])×10[superscript -3] as the arithmetic average of four results obtained from four different QCD predictions of the partial rate. We separately determine partial branching fractions for B̅[superscript 0] and B[superscript -] decays and derive a limit on the isospin breaking in B̅→X[subscript u]ℓν̅ decays.
